Hey, Ina! Do you know the correct way to cut a pomegranate? How would you slice it to get the seeds out of ever cavity before juicing it? Also, has anyone tried chocolate covered pomegranate seeds? YUM!

Honestly never done anything with pomegranate... but lets see if I can find out.

wiki says...

After opening the pomegranate by scoring it with a knife and breaking it open, the arils (seed casings) are separated from the peel and internal white pulp membranes. Separating the red arils is easier in a bowl of water, because the arils sink and the inedible pulp floats. Freezing the entire fruit also makes it easier to separate. Another very effective way of quickly harvesting the arils is to cut the pomegranate in half, score each half of the exterior rind four to six times, hold the pomegranate half over a bowl and smack the rind with a large spoon. The arils should eject from the pomegranate directly into the bowl, leaving only a dozen or more deeply embedded arils to remove.
